Author: michiel
Date: 2010-05-15 00:57:50 +0200 (Sat, 15 May 2010)
New Revision: 42153

Added:
   
speeltuin/mihxil/portal/trunk/src/main/config/builders/core/componentblocks.xml
Removed:
   speeltuin/mihxil/portal/trunk/src/main/config/builders/core/blocks.xml
Modified:
   speeltuin/mihxil/portal/trunk/src/main/config/applications/Portal.xml
   
speeltuin/mihxil/portal/trunk/src/main/java/org/mmbase/framework/BlocksToDatabaseSyncer.java
   
speeltuin/mihxil/portal/trunk/src/main/resources/META-INF/tags/mm/portal/blocks.tagx
   speeltuin/mihxil/portal/trunk/test-webapp/src/main/webapp/edit/page/page.js
Log:
blocks gives rise to conflicts (e.g. with richtext)

Modified: speeltuin/mihxil/portal/trunk/src/main/config/applications/Portal.xml
===================================================================
--- speeltuin/mihxil/portal/trunk/src/main/config/applications/Portal.xml       
2010-05-14 22:39:40 UTC (rev 42152)
+++ speeltuin/mihxil/portal/trunk/src/main/config/applications/Portal.xml       
2010-05-14 22:57:50 UTC (rev 42153)
@@ -8,7 +8,7 @@
 
   <neededbuilderlist>
     <builder maintainer="mmbase.org" version="1">pages</builder>
-    <builder maintainer="mmbase.org" version="1">blocks</builder>
+    <builder maintainer="mmbase.org" version="1">componentblocks</builder>
     <builder maintainer="mmbase.org" version="1">blockposrel</builder>
     <builder maintainer="mmbase.org" version="1">cartesianrel</builder>
   </neededbuilderlist>
@@ -19,7 +19,7 @@
   </neededreldeflist>
 
   <allowedrelationlist>
-    <relation from="pages"    to="blocks" type="blockposrel" />
+    <relation from="pages"    to="componentblocks" type="blockposrel" />
   </allowedrelationlist>
 
   <datasourcelist>

Deleted: speeltuin/mihxil/portal/trunk/src/main/config/builders/core/blocks.xml
===================================================================
--- speeltuin/mihxil/portal/trunk/src/main/config/builders/core/blocks.xml      
2010-05-14 22:39:40 UTC (rev 42152)
+++ speeltuin/mihxil/portal/trunk/src/main/config/builders/core/blocks.xml      
2010-05-14 22:57:50 UTC (rev 42153)
@@ -1,108 +0,0 @@
-<?xml version="1.0" ?>
-<builder
-    xmlns="http://www.mmbase.org/xmlns/builder";
-    x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ance";
-    xsi:schemaLocation="http://www.mmbase.org/xmlns/builder 
http://www.mmbase.org/xmlns/builder.xsd";
-    name="blocks" maintainer="mmbase.org" version="1" extends="object">
-  <searchage>3000</searchage>
-  <names>
-    <singular xml:lang="en">Webblock</singular>
-    <singular xml:lang="nl">Webblok</singular>
-    <plural xml:lang="en">Webblocks</plural>
-    <plural xml:lang="nl">Webblokken</plural>
-  </names>
-
-  <descriptions>
-    <description xml:lang="en">
-      Building blocks for a (home)page
-    </description>
-    <description xml:lang="nl">
-      Bouwblokken voor een (home)page
-    </description>
-  </descriptions>
-
-  <fieldlist>
-     <field name="component" state="persistent">
-       <gui>
-         <guiname xml:lang="nl">Component</guiname>
-         <guiname xml:lang="en">Component</guiname>
-         <guiname xml:lang="zh">模型</guiname>
-       </gui>
-      <editor>
-        <positions>
-          <list>1</list>
-        </positions>
-      </editor>
-       <datatype base="components" 
xmlns="http://www.mmbase.org/xmlns/datatypes"; />
-     </field>
-    <field name="name">
-      <descriptions>
-        <description xml:lang="en">Name of the webblock</description>
-        <description xml:lang="nl">Naam van de webblok</description>
-      </descriptions>
-      <gui>
-        <guiname xml:lang="en">Name</guiname>
-        <guiname xml:lang="nl">Naam</guiname>
-      </gui>
-      <editor>
-        <positions>
-          <list>2</list>
-        </positions>
-      </editor>
-      <datatype base="eline" xmlns="http://www.mmbase.org/xmlns/datatypes"; >
-        <required value="true" />
-        <maxLength value="126" />
-      </datatype>
-    </field>
-
-    <field name="description">
-      <descriptions>
-        <description xml:lang="en">Description</description>
-        <description xml:lang="nl">Omschrijving van een webblock</description>
-      </descriptions>
-
-      <gui>
-        <guiname xml:lang="nl">Omschrijving</guiname>
-        <guiname xml:lang="en">Description</guiname>
-      </gui>
-      <datatype base="field" xmlns="http://www.mmbase.org/xmlns/datatypes"; >
-        <maxLength value="2048" />
-      </datatype>
-    </field>
-
-    <field name="windowstate">
-      <gui>
-        <guiname xml:lang="nl">Weergave</guiname>
-        <guiname xml:lang="en">Display Type</guiname>
-      </gui>
-      <datatype base="windowstate" 
xmlns="http://www.mmbase.org/xmlns/datatypes";>
-        <default value="NORMAL" />
-      </datatype>
-    </field>
-    <field name="refreshpolicy">
-      <gui>
-        <guiname xml:lang="nl">Cacherefreshpolicy</guiname>
-        <guiname xml:lang="en">Cache refresh policy</guiname>
-      </gui>
-      <datatype base="string" xmlns="http://www.mmbase.org/xmlns/datatypes";>
-        <default value="org.mmbase.portal.refresh.Expires" />
-        <enumeration>
-          <entry value="org.mmbase.portal.refresh.Always"  display="always" />
-          <entry value="org.mmbase.portal.refresh.Expires" display="expires" />
-          <entry value="org.mmbase.portal.refresh.Never"   display="never" />
-        </enumeration>
-      </datatype>
-    </field>
-    <field name="refreshpolicyparam">
-      <gui>
-        <guiname xml:lang="nl">Cacherefreshpolicy</guiname>
-        <guiname xml:lang="en">Cache refresh policy</guiname>
-      </gui>
-      <datatype base="string" xmlns="http://www.mmbase.org/xmlns/datatypes";>
-        <default value="3600" /> <!-- 1 hour -->
-      </datatype>
-    </field>
-
-
-  </fieldlist>
-</builder>

Copied: 
speeltuin/mihxil/portal/trunk/src/main/config/builders/core/componentblocks.xml 
(from rev 42067, 
speeltuin/mihxil/portal/trunk/src/main/config/builders/core/blocks.xml)
===================================================================
--- 
speeltuin/mihxil/portal/trunk/src/main/config/builders/core/componentblocks.xml 
                            (rev 0)
+++ 
speeltuin/mihxil/portal/trunk/src/main/config/builders/core/componentblocks.xml 
    2010-05-14 22:57:50 UTC (rev 42153)
@@ -0,0 +1,108 @@
+<?xml version="1.0" ?>
+<builder
+    xmlns="http://www.mmbase.org/xmlns/builder";
+    x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ance";
+    xsi:schemaLocation="http://www.mmbase.org/xmlns/builder 
http://www.mmbase.org/xmlns/builder.xsd";
+    name="componentblocks" maintainer="mmbase.org" version="1" 
extends="object">
+  <searchage>3000</searchage>
+  <names>
+    <singular xml:lang="en">Webblock</singular>
+    <singular xml:lang="nl">Webblok</singular>
+    <plural xml:lang="en">Webblocks</plural>
+    <plural xml:lang="nl">Webblokken</plural>
+  </names>
+
+  <descriptions>
+    <description xml:lang="en">
+      Building blocks for a (home)page
+    </description>
+    <description xml:lang="nl">
+      Bouwblokken voor een (home)page
+    </description>
+  </descriptions>
+
+  <fieldlist>
+     <field name="component" state="persistent">
+       <gui>
+         <guiname xml:lang="nl">Component</guiname>
+         <guiname xml:lang="en">Component</guiname>
+         <guiname xml:lang="zh">模型</guiname>
+       </gui>
+      <editor>
+        <positions>
+          <list>1</list>
+        </positions>
+      </editor>
+       <datatype base="components" 
xmlns="http://www.mmbase.org/xmlns/datatypes"; />
+     </field>
+    <field name="name">
+      <descriptions>
+        <description xml:lang="en">Name of the webblock</description>
+        <description xml:lang="nl">Naam van de webblok</description>
+      </descriptions>
+      <gui>
+        <guiname xml:lang="en">Name</guiname>
+        <guiname xml:lang="nl">Naam</guiname>
+      </gui>
+      <editor>
+        <positions>
+          <list>2</list>
+        </positions>
+      </editor>
+      <datatype base="eline" xmlns="http://www.mmbase.org/xmlns/datatypes"; >
+        <required value="true" />
+        <maxLength value="126" />
+      </datatype>
+    </field>
+
+    <field name="description">
+      <descriptions>
+        <description xml:lang="en">Description</description>
+        <description xml:lang="nl">Omschrijving van een webblock</description>
+      </descriptions>
+
+      <gui>
+        <guiname xml:lang="nl">Omschrijving</guiname>
+        <guiname xml:lang="en">Description</guiname>
+      </gui>
+      <datatype base="field" xmlns="http://www.mmbase.org/xmlns/datatypes"; >
+        <maxLength value="2048" />
+      </datatype>
+    </field>
+
+    <field name="windowstate">
+      <gui>
+        <guiname xml:lang="nl">Weergave</guiname>
+        <guiname xml:lang="en">Display Type</guiname>
+      </gui>
+      <datatype base="windowstate" 
xmlns="http://www.mmbase.org/xmlns/datatypes";>
+        <default value="NORMAL" />
+      </datatype>
+    </field>
+    <field name="refreshpolicy">
+      <gui>
+        <guiname xml:lang="nl">Cacherefreshpolicy</guiname>
+        <guiname xml:lang="en">Cache refresh policy</guiname>
+      </gui>
+      <datatype base="string" xmlns="http://www.mmbase.org/xmlns/datatypes";>
+        <default value="org.mmbase.portal.refresh.Expires" />
+        <enumeration>
+          <entry value="org.mmbase.portal.refresh.Always"  display="always" />
+          <entry value="org.mmbase.portal.refresh.Expires" display="expires" />
+          <entry value="org.mmbase.portal.refresh.Never"   display="never" />
+        </enumeration>
+      </datatype>
+    </field>
+    <field name="refreshpolicyparam">
+      <gui>
+        <guiname xml:lang="nl">Cacherefreshpolicy</guiname>
+        <guiname xml:lang="en">Cache refresh policy</guiname>
+      </gui>
+      <datatype base="string" xmlns="http://www.mmbase.org/xmlns/datatypes";>
+        <default value="3600" /> <!-- 1 hour -->
+      </datatype>
+    </field>
+
+
+  </fieldlist>
+</builder>

Modified: 
speeltuin/mihxil/portal/trunk/src/main/java/org/mmbase/framework/BlocksToDatabaseSyncer.java
===================================================================
--- 
speeltuin/mihxil/portal/trunk/src/main/java/org/mmbase/framework/BlocksToDatabaseSyncer.java
        2010-05-14 22:39:40 UTC (rev 42152)
+++ 
speeltuin/mihxil/portal/trunk/src/main/java/org/mmbase/framework/BlocksToDatabaseSyncer.java
        2010-05-14 22:57:50 UTC (rev 42153)
@@ -36,7 +36,7 @@
     public void notify(SystemEvent event) {
         if (event instanceof ComponentRepository.Ready) {
             Cloud cloud = 
ContextProvider.getDefaultCloudContext().getCloud("mmbase", "class", null);
-            NodeManager blocks = cloud.getNodeManager("blocks");
+            NodeManager blocks = cloud.getNodeManager("componentblocks");
             LOG.service("Syncing blocks builder with" + 
ComponentRepository.getInstance());
             for (Component component : 
ComponentRepository.getInstance().getComponents()) {
                 LOG.service("Syncing component " + component);

Modified: 
speeltuin/mihxil/portal/trunk/src/main/resources/META-INF/tags/mm/portal/blocks.tagx
===================================================================
--- 
speeltuin/mihxil/portal/trunk/src/main/resources/META-INF/tags/mm/portal/blocks.tagx
        2010-05-14 22:39:40 UTC (rev 42152)
+++ 
speeltuin/mihxil/portal/trunk/src/main/resources/META-INF/tags/mm/portal/blocks.tagx
        2010-05-14 22:57:50 UTC (rev 42153)
@@ -18,7 +18,7 @@
                           />
   <mm:node id="page">
     <div class="mm_portal_content">
-      <mm:listrelationscontainer type="blocks" role="blockposrel">
+      <mm:listrelationscontainer type="componentblocks" role="blockposrel">
         <mm:sortorder field="blockposrel.x" />
         <mm:sortorder field="blockposrel.y" />
         <mm:listrelations id="blockposrel">

Modified: 
speeltuin/mihxil/portal/trunk/test-webapp/src/main/webapp/edit/page/page.js
===================================================================
--- speeltuin/mihxil/portal/trunk/test-webapp/src/main/webapp/edit/page/page.js 
2010-05-14 22:39:40 UTC (rev 42152)
+++ speeltuin/mihxil/portal/trunk/test-webapp/src/main/webapp/edit/page/page.js 
2010-05-14 22:57:50 UTC (rev 42153)
@@ -14,8 +14,8 @@
                          var x = $(this).find("span.x");
                          var y = $(this).find("span.y");
                          var position = $(this).position();
-                         x.text("" + position.left / 150);
-                         y.text("" + position.top / 150);
+                         x.text("" + parseInt(position.left / 150));
+                         y.text("" + parseInt(position.top / 150));
                      }
                  );
              }

_______________________________________________
Cvs mailing list
[email protected]
http://lists.mmbase.org/mailman/listinfo/cvs

Reply via email to